Material Name

ABS

Material Type
Plastic
Process Compatibility
CNC Machining
Property Value
Mechanical Properties
Ultimate tensile strength 27.6 – 55.2 MPa
Yield strength 18.5 – 51 MPa
Young’s modulus (modulus of elasticity) 1.1 – 2.9 GPa
Elongation at break 10 – 50 %
Hardness 5.6 – 15.3 HV
Physical Properties
UV resistance Poor
Thermal Properties
Maximum service temperature 61.9 – 76.9 °C
Thermal expansion coefficient 84.6 – 234 × 10-6/ºC
Thermal conductivity 0.188 – 0.335 W/(m·°C)
Electrical Properties
ESD Safety No

ABS vs Polycarbonate Machining: Which is Better?

While both materials are durable, ABS is easier to machine and more cost-effective. Polycarbonate can be more abrasive on tools and more expensive, but it is stronger and more resistant to heat. When choosing between ABS vs polycarbonate machining, consider:

Feature

ABS

Polycarbonate

Machinability Excellent Moderate
Cost Lower Higher
Heat Resistance Good Excellent
Impact Strength High Higher
CNC Precision Excellent Excellent

Frequently Asked Questions About CNC ABS

What is ABS used for in CNC machining?

ABS is used for prototypes, housings, brackets, and other durable components that require impact resistance and dimensional stability.

Can ABS be CNC machined easily?

Yes. CNC machining ABS is relatively easy due to its low melting point and good machinability, making it perfect for milling, turning, and drilling.

How does ABS compare to polycarbonate in machining?

ABS is easier and cheaper to machine, while polycarbonate offers more strength and heat resistance. Select according to your practical requirements.

What are typical ABS CNC machining tolerances?

Typical ABS tolerances in CNC machining are ±0.005″, but tighter tolerances can be achieved with high-precision equipment.
